Facts about the blind and visually impaired

  • There are approximately 10 million blind and visually impaired people in the United States.
  • Approximately 1.3 million Americans are legally blind.
  • There are approximately 5.5 million elderly individuals who are blind or visually impaired.
  • Approximately 93,600 visually impaired or blind students are served by special education programs
  • There are approximately 55,200 legally blind children.
  • Approximately 109,000 visually impaired people in the United States use white canes to get around
  • Just over 7,000 Americans use dog guides.
  • Approximately 5,500 legally blind children use Braille as their primary reading medium.
  • At least 1.5 million blind and visually impaired Americans use computers.
  • Approximately 46% of visually impaired adult Americans are employed.
  • Statistics provided by the American Foundation for the blind
